Overview

Standalone equipment encompasses a broad range of machinery and devices designed to operate independently, without the need for integration into complex systems. These units are prevalent across various industries, including manufacturing, healthcare, agriculture, and laboratories. Their primary advantage lies in their simplicity and portability, making them ideal for small-scale operations or specialized tasks. Standalone equipment is often favored for its ease of installation and minimal setup requirements. Unlike integrated systems, these devices can be deployed quickly and require less technical expertise to operate. This makes them particularly useful in environments where flexibility and rapid deployment are critical.

Structure and Working Principle

The structure of standalone equipment varies significantly depending on its intended application. However, most units share common components such as a power source, control panel, and functional modules tailored to specific tasks. For example, a standalone medical diagnostic device may include sensors, display screens, and data processing units. The working principle of standalone equipment typically involves converting input energy or data into a desired output. For instance, a standalone CNC machine tool processes raw materials into finished parts using programmed instructions. The absence of external dependencies allows these devices to function autonomously, ensuring consistent performance in diverse environments.

Key Features

Standalone equipment is characterized by its independence, portability, and user-friendly design. These features make it highly versatile and suitable for a wide range of applications. For example, standalone air compressors are widely used in construction sites due to their mobility and self-contained operation. Another key feature is the minimal infrastructure required for deployment. Unlike integrated systems, standalone devices often need only a power source and basic operational space. This reduces overhead costs and simplifies logistics, making them a cost-effective solution for many businesses.

Application Areas

Standalone equipment finds applications in numerous industries. In healthcare, devices like portable ultrasound machines and blood analyzers provide critical diagnostic capabilities in remote or resource-limited settings. In agriculture, standalone irrigation systems and soil testing devices enhance productivity and efficiency. Manufacturing facilities often use standalone CNC machines, laser cutters, and 3D printers for prototyping and small-batch production. Laboratories rely on standalone centrifuges, spectrophotometers, and autoclaves for research and testing. The versatility of standalone equipment ensures its relevance across diverse sectors.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and optimal performance of standalone equipment. This includes routine inspections, cleaning, and timely replacement of worn-out parts. For example, lubrication of moving components in machinery prevents friction-related wear and tear. Safety precautions are equally important. Operators should follow manufacturer guidelines, use protective gear, and ensure proper ventilation when necessary. Electrical safety measures, such as grounding and surge protection, are critical for devices powered by electricity. Adhering to these practices minimizes risks and enhances operational efficiency.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ring standalone equipment, businesses should consider factors such as application requirements, durability, and supplier reputation. It's advisable to evaluate multiple vendors, compare specifications, and request product demonstrations before making a purchase. Cost is another critical factor, but it should not compromise quality. Opting for slightly more expensive, reliable equipment can reduce long-term maintenance and replacement costs. Additionally, warranties and after-sales support are vital considerations, as they ensure ongoing assistance and spare parts availability.
